US Education Department veterans blast Trump plan to transfer programs
Former U.S. Department of Education officials, spanning both Republican and Democratic administrations, have criticized plans by the Trump administration to transfer key programs like special education and civil rights enforcement to other agencies. These officials, brought together by Democratic Sen. Patty Murray, argue that such moves could undermine decades of progress in educational equity and accessibility. The concern is that shifting these critical responsibilities could lead to inconsistent enforcement and neglect, especially for marginalized student groups. This backlash underscores a broader debate about the stability and integrity of federal education policies.
